Q: Is 618,088 a Prime Number?

 A: No, 618,088 is not a prime number.

Why is 618,088 not a prime number?

A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.

The number 618088 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 77,261 154,522 309,044 and 618,088, with no remainder.

Since 618,088 cannot be divided by just 1 and 618,088, it is not a prime number.
